Baku Olympic Stadium SISGrass

Two of the most prestigious matches in the European football calendar are set to be staged on revolutionary SISGrass surfaces.

The impressive Olympic Stadium in Baku has been chosen to host the 2019 UEFA Europa League final on May 29 – the first such high-profile fixture to be played in Azerbaijan.

Later that year, the 2019 UEFA Super Cup will be held at Beşiktas’ spectacular Vodafone Arena in Istanbul on August 14.

Both stadiums boast pitches fit for games of such magnitude thanks to the award-winning SISGrass hybrid pitch system.

The brainchild of UK-based SIS Pitches, SISGrass is a reinforced natural turf system featuring patented fibre injection technology.

Both venues were selected at a recent UEFA Executive Committee meeting in Nyon.

SIS Pitches have helped the Baku Olympic Stadium Complex become the face of Azerbaijan’s football and sport facilities, having also constructed the warm-up stadium pitch and training pitch.

It’s a similar story in Istanbul, where SISGrass technology was used to reconstruct the Vodafone Arena’s training pitch before being introduced inside the stadium, including a synthetic installation around the pitch perimeter.

The Vodafone Arena was also the first venue in Turkey to feature SIS Pitches’ patented SISAir, a ground-breaking undersoil aeriation system.

SISGrass’ laser-guided installation combines a 95% natural grass pitch with 5% of specially-designed PE yarn stitched into the ground, offering unrivalled durability, improved pitch recovery time and increased playing hours.

SISGrass has been installed at many other prestigious venues across the globe, including the iconic Luzhniki Stadium, which will host the Russia in 2018 final.

SISGrass has been introduced at Premier League duo Newcastle United and AFC Bournemouth, Serie A side Verona and a quartet of Türkish Super Lig clubs.

It also features at Championship clubs Birmingham City, Derby County, Reading and Fulham and at the training grounds of FC Barcelona, Chelsea, Swansea City, Hull City, Fulham, Derby County and the National Football Centre at St. George’s Park, home of the English FA.
